Orzo with Roasted Veg Sauce

Serving Size and Yield
This recipe serves approximately 4 people.
Preparation and Cooking Time
Preparation Time: 15 minutes
Cooking Time: 30 minutes
Total Time: 45 minutes
Ingredients
- 1 cup orzo pasta
- 1 red bell pepper, chopped
- 1 zucchini, sliced
- 1 red onion, ch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 2 cups vegetable broth
- 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ese (optional)
- Fresh basil leaves for garnish
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Prepare the vegetables by chopping the red bell pepper, slicing the zucchini, and chopping the red onion. Mince the garlic.
- Toss the chopped vegetables and garlic with olive oil, oregano, salt, and pepper in a large bowl.
- Spread the vegetables on a baking sheet and roast in the preheated oven for 20 minutes, or until they are tender and slightly caramelized.
- Cook the orzo according to package instructions, using vegetable broth instead of water for added flavor. Drain and set aside.
- Blend the roasted vegetables in a blender or food processor until smooth, adding a little vegetable broth if needed to reach your desired sauce consistency.
- Combine the cooked orzo with the roasted vegetable sauce in a large bowl. Stir well to coat the orzo evenly.
- Serve the orzo warm, topped with grated Parmesan cheese and fresh basil leaves if desired.
Additional Notes
For a vegan version, omit the Parmesan cheese or substitute with nutritional yeast. You can also add other vegetables like eggplant or cherry tomatoes for variation. This dish pairs well with a side salad or crusty bread.
